Srinagar, Jan 24
– A land where snow-draped mountains kiss azure skies, where shimmering lakes reflect serene landscapes, and where every corner whispers tales of cultural richness — Kashmir is no longer just a dream destination for domestic travellers but a rising star on the global tourism map.

Recent statistics reveal that the Kashmir Valley has become an unmissable bucket-list destination for travellers worldwide. With 43,654 international tourists visiting the valley in 2024 (a record-breaking 16% increase from the previous year) and nearly 2.94 million domestic visitors, Kashmir is capturing hearts like never before.

Unparalleled Growth in Global Tourism : Thanks to relentless efforts by the Kashmir Tourism Department and leading travel partners like JKL Travels, the valley is now a global tourism hotspot. Participation in international fairs, roadshows, and creative digital marketing campaigns has positioned Kashmir as a safe, serene, and sustainable destination for travellers from Europe, the Middle East, and Southeast Asia.

In July 2024, peak tourist activity soared, with over 500,000 visitors flocking to Kashmir, a significant chunk being international travellers. This surge speaks volumes about Kashmir’s growing appeal as a destination for leisure, adventure, and cultural tourism.

1. Gulmarg: A Snowy Paradise for Adventure Lovers

From Asia’s highest cable car (the iconic Gulmarg Gondola) to thrilling skiing and snowboarding adventures, Gulmarg is a winter wonderland that caters to adrenaline junkies and nature lovers alike. The picturesque snow-covered meadows and quaint cafes offering steaming hot kahwa make it the ultimate snowy escape.

3. Pahalgam: Bollywood’s Favorite Backdrop

Known for its cinematic charm, Pahalgam becomes even more magical under a blanket of snow. Walk along the frozen Lidder River, enjoy sledge rides through Aru Valley, or simply capture Instagram-worthy shots in this romantic destination.

4. Sonamarg: Solitude Amidst Snowy Meadows

The enchanting Sonamarg, or “Meadow of Gold,” transforms into a pristine white wonderland during winter. It’s a haven for those seeking peace, solitude, and awe-inspiring landscapes. Visit the Thajiwas Glacier for thrilling sledge rides or enjoy serene treks amidst the snow.

6. Doodhpathri: The Valley of Virgin Snow

Nicknamed the “Valley of Milk,” Doodhpathri is pure bliss. Whether it’s building snowmen, sledging with kids, or simply basking in the quiet beauty, this serene valley is perfect for families and eco-conscious travellers.

7. Kupwara and Lolab Valley: Offbeat Adventures Await

For those who love exploring off-the-beaten-path destinations, Kupwara and Lolab Valley offer pristine landscapes untouched by crowds. These regions are ideal for nature lovers, trekkers, and photographers seeking unparalleled views of Kashmir’s wild beauty.

1. Authentic Cultural Experiences

From sipping aromatic Kashmiri kahwa to indulging in a traditional Wazwan feast, every meal in Kashmir is a cultural journey. Visit local markets to shop for pashmina shawls, saffron, and handcrafted souvenirs that carry the valley’s timeless charm.
